NORTHAMPTON, Mass.--The final regular season road game is on hand for the Smith College soccer team (5-7, 2-4 NEWMAC), when they travel to Worcester Polytechnic Institute (5-8, 1-5 NEWMAC) on Tuesday night.
Last Meeting: WPI clinched a berth in the NEWMAC tournament with a
1-0 win over Smith on October 30, 2010.
Last Smith Win: Dalyn Houser netted her sixth goal of the season with eight minutes left in regulation to lift
Smith to a 2-1 win over the Engineers on October 6, 2007.
Smith Overview: Smith suffered a 4-1 loss to Babson in the Pioneers' last game.
Lily Eriksen (Seattle, Wash./Bush School) tied up the contest with her second goal of the season earl yin the second half, but the Beavers scored three times in the final 25 minutes.
Cody Norris (Auburn, Mass./Auburn) made 14 saves.
WPI Overview: The Engineers have lost two in a row, including a 1-0 overtime defeat to Clark on Saturday. The Engineers have had their last three NEWMAC contests decided by one goal.
Smith Player to Watch: Eriksen has scored the last two goals for Smith, all off the bench. An efficient player, half her shots are on goal thus far this year.
WPI Player to Watch: Megan Forti has potted four goals, and set up five on the season.
Did you know? This contest did not take place last season - initially delayed because of a massive snowstorm, the game was eventually cancelled.
